Bowl is Put to the Test

While the  brains at Spohn Ranch had gone above and beyond with double and triple checking the engineering behind the portable concrete bowl, there was still one main unanswered question going into the Dew Tour’s first Skate Bowl event in Ocean City – how would it skate?  As the installation was nearing the final hours, Chris Miller was about to burst with anticipation – ” I don’t want to claim too hard, but if it skates as good as it looks, the Dew Tour Bowl might be one of the best ever!”

As soon as the final flatwork sections cured, the Spohn Ranch crew,  along with Chris Miller, Bucky Lasek, Andy McDonald and Steve Caballero put it to the test.  The overwhelming response was “this bowl is insanely awesome!!!”.  A few Facebook updates from Cab, a true skateboarding pioneer, put things in perspective:

“Ok you guys… This bowl is amazing! So smooth and so many lines in this thing, can’t wait to ride it again tomorrow for qualifying 🙂 hope I make it in!”

“This bowl is insane and i can’t believe it’s portable too and going to Portland next, amazing time we live in these days :)”

After three days of amazing skating from the top professional skaters in the world, Pedro Barros, Bucky Lasek and Ben Hatchell ended up on the podium.  To check out the highlights from the first Dew Tour Skate Bowl contest, check the video below!  And here’s a recap of the event via Alli Sports.
